I got my first fill on Thursday, 2 cc's in a 10 cc band. Doc said I wouldn't feel any restriction, and I don't... but I do feel like there's just a little pressure. I have an air issue, but that seems to be ok too. I'm not eating normally, but almost.

I'm ready for another fill already. It's really hard to be patient when it seems like I've waited my whole life for this opportunity.

I'm ready for it to work now.

Today was weigh in day. I lost a pound!!!! I am thrilled with this considering I ate a whole box of Girl Scout Cookies on Thursday. Imagine what my loss would have been without those extra calories and carbs from those. I have been looking over my food journals and there is a strong correlation between Protein and loss. I really have to go low carb or else I don't lose. I can have 900 calories and day and not lose if they are carb calories. I can have more calories and lose more with less carbs and noticably more protien.

So that's the plan for the next few weeks.

Ugh! Temptation!! I really really wanted a piece of toast today. Damn bread is my biggest temptation and it's been a month! So I tried some.. and it was delicious!! Sadly I felt it all get stuck and thought.. I better go walk or stretch or something to help this food get unstuck. Yeah nothing worked.. I kept burping and my saliva was not going through...pain pain pain!! Then all of a sudden it just all came back up. Gross!!!!!!! Seriously was so glad to have a bunch of napkins on hand in an empty cafeteria. NO MORE BREAD!!!

It amazes me how many seem to have good restriction without getting a fill. I have had a fill of 3cc in my 10cc band and have not had a PB or a slime. (Seriously not complaining about that!) If I don't chew my meat well enough I feel a bit of pressure...what I know is a sign to slow the heck down before something bad will happen, but no PB or slime. I plan on getting another fill on Friday.

I guess I just feel a bit jealous of you guys who feel the restircion without the fills.
